From 68c30b4af1b1d6f95ae6724364641aa787247f0f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: "Shawn O. Pearce" Date: Sun, 21 Jan 2007 13:27:43 -0500 Subject: [PATCH] git-gui: Add Refresh to diff viewer context menu. Sometimes you want to just force the diff to redisplay itself without rescanning every file in the filesystem (as that can be very costly on large projects and slow operating systems). Now you can force a diff-only refresh from the context menu. Previously you could also do this by reclicking on the file name in the UI, but it may not be obvious to all users, having a context menu option makes it more clear. Signed-off-by: Shawn O.
